Advanced Orchestration in Automation Intelligence Workflow Automation
Modern enterprises are moving beyond basic Robotic Process Automation to sophisticated orchestration layers. This approach utilizes intelligent process discovery to map handoffs in real-time, ensuring data flows without manual intervention. By embedding decision-making logic directly into the transition points between systems, organizations achieve true end-to-end processing.
Key pillars include:
- Predictive exception handling using machine learning.
- Real-time event-driven triggers that replace batch processing.
- Unified visibility dashboards for cross-departmental accountability.
The business impact is significant, as it drastically reduces lead times for customer onboarding and financial reconciliation. A practical implementation insight involves prioritizing high-volume, low-complexity handoffs to demonstrate rapid ROI before scaling to intricate multi-departmental workflows.
Cognitive Handoffs and Intelligent Integration
Cognitive handoffs utilize automation intelligence workflow automation to interpret unstructured data, such as emails or legal documents, before moving them to downstream systems. Unlike static integrations, cognitive layers adapt to variations in data format, significantly increasing straight-through processing rates. This ensures that information remains accurate and actionable across the entire value chain.
Strategic benefits for executives include:
- Enhanced data integrity during system migrations.
- Reduced operational friction in supply chain management.
- Increased agility to adjust workflows based on market demands.
To succeed, leadership must treat these handoffs as strategic assets rather than mere technical tasks. Focus on creating modular workflows that allow for agile updates as business requirements evolve.
Key Challenges
The primary barrier is often legacy system resistance and data siloing. Teams must overcome technical debt to allow for seamless API-led connectivity between platforms.
Best Practices
Adopting a “process-first” mindset is essential. Document every touchpoint, validate data quality at the source, and monitor performance metrics continuously to identify bottlenecks early.
Governance Alignment
Robust IT governance ensures compliance while scaling. Implement strict audit trails for every automated handoff to meet regulatory requirements and maintain full internal control.

Q: How does automation intelligence improve upon traditional RPA?
Traditional RPA follows rigid rules, while automation intelligence incorporates machine learning to handle exceptions and unstructured data. This allows workflows to adapt to changes without requiring constant manual intervention.
Q: What is the most critical factor for successful workflow automation?
The most critical factor is process standardization before implementation. Automating a broken or poorly defined process only accelerates inefficiency, making clear documentation essential.
Q: How do we ensure compliance during automated handoffs?
Compliance is maintained by embedding audit logs and real-time monitoring into the workflow design. This ensures every action is tracked, documented, and aligned with internal governance standards.
